Types of Dental Implants


Missing Teeth Replacement
Single or Multiple Dental Implants
For people missing one or more teeth and who want a long-lasting, natural-looking replacement, dental implants may be a suitable option.
For single or multiple missing teeth, titanium post/s are placed into the jawbone and act as an artificial tooth root. A custom-made crown or bridge is then made to match the rest of the teeth and is attached to the implant, blending seamlessly with the natural teeth.


All-On-X dental implants require replacing an entire set of upper or lower teeth with dental implants. These are generally considered when a person has lost most or all of their natural teeth and they’re looking for a permanent solution. This process involves placing four to six dental implants to support a full mouth denture. As with implants for missing teeth replacement, this procedure aims to replicate natural teeth as closely as possible.

For most patients, the dental implant process takes approximately three months and often looks like:




Consultation, Treatment Planning, and Preparation
In the first stage, we examine your teeth and gums in detail and take a radiograph to assess bone level and density. We will then create a dental plan outlining the timing of each stage, a full breakdown of the cost, and any other concerns you or the team may have. If you require any preparatory procedures, such as tooth extraction or bone grafting, this will be done here. Placement of Implant, Integration Period, and Tooth Restoration
During this stage, a titanium screw will be placed in the jawbone. We typically use local anaesthetic to ensure this procedure is as pain-free as possible. Following this, there will be an integration period where the bone adapts to the titanium screw, and this typically takes 10-12 weeks (though it may vary from person to person). We may also place a temporary tooth in the spot during this time. Once the bone adapts to the screw, we restore the implant with a porcelain (ceramic) tooth or denture, aiming for optimal functional and aesthetically pleasing results.


Aftercare
Once the dental implant is in place, it’s important to keep the surrounding gums healthy. This is crucial as it aims to increase the life of the implant. Even when your implant feels as natural as the rest of your teeth, ensure you come in for regular aftercare checkups so that we can monitor it.
